Average Wooden fencing cost in Wantage

The regular cost of a new or replacement fence is approximately £20-£45 per foot, not including removing your existing fence which could cost an extra £5-10 per foot. The labour costs depend on the length and height of your fence, the number of posts and the material used. It will also differ among regions, so it's best to get a few quotes to see what the best price is in your area.

Wantage

Wantage is a market community and also civil parish in the Vale of the White Horse in the English region of Oxfordshire. The community gets on Letcombe Creek, about 8 miles (13 km) south-west of Abingdon, 10 miles (16 kilometres) west of Didcot, 15 miles (24 kilometres) south-west of Oxford and 14 miles (23 km) north north-west of Newbury. Historically component of Berkshire, it is notable as the birth place of King Alfred the Great in 849. In 1974 the area carried out by Berkshire County Council was considerably decreased, and Wantage, in usual with other territories South of the River Thames, ended up being part of a substantially enlarged Oxfordshire. According to the 2011 Census, the town has a permanent resident population of approximately 11,327 individuals. Wantage includes the suburbs of Belmont to the west and Charlton to the eastern. The Edgehill Springs rise between Manor Road and also Spike Lodge Farms and the Letcombe Brook flows through the town. There is a huge market square having a statuary of King Alfred, bordered by stores some with 18th-century fronts. In the last few years, some considerable real estate developments have been constructed. In 2006, an industrial growth began building with a grocery store as a focus. This grocery store is double the dimension of the previous one and was meant to have a significant influence on the community by drawing more site visitors from provincial towns. The effect was predicted as declaring, focused on preventing the community ending up being a traveler town and retaining some business task. In 2014, Wantage was nominated for the Federal government's Great British High Street Award whereby Wantage won the honor for Britain's Best Town Centre, beating several various other communities nominated for the honor.     How close can I build to my neighbour’s fence?

    As a home or property owner, you’re generally allowed to build next to your neighbour’s fence as long as it’s on your own side of the property. With that in mind, there are certain laws that regulate how close a fence can be built to buildings on the same lot or neighbouring lots. In addition, there are also local bylaws that provide limitations on the placements as well as height of fences so as to address safety hazards. In this post, we’re going to give you a good insight into how close you can build to your neighbour. Let’s take a look!

     

    In general, if the fence is in your boundary then you’re allowed to build a 2-metre high brick or wooden fence or wall. However, this may differ depending on your location in the UK. As a result, you may want to reach out to your municipality’s building department in order to determine what these rules and limitations are in your area. In the events whereby there are no such restrictions but you’re still concerned, you can try informing your neighbour what your concerns are. However, if they’re not receptive there are some steps you can take to ensure your plans go as smoothly as possible. These steps include the following:

    • Ensure to leave sufficient space for both the posts and footings
    • Stagger your fence posts in order to make sure you’re not digging your neighbour’s
    • Consider using concrete posts as they’re much stronger and will last a lot longer
    • Use kickers or plinths for raised gardens and flower beds
    • Make use of concrete plinths as they won’t rot over time like a wooden fence.
    Do I need to tell my neighbours if I’m going to replace my fence?

    It’s a good idea to talk to your neighbours before you start any work to avoid confusion along the way. But if the fence is definitely your responsibility and on your property, there’s no legal obligation to notify them. It’s also a myth that you need to erect a fence with the flush side without posts facing your neighbour’s property.

    What is the cheapest fence to install?

    The cheapest fence to install is, generally, a pressure-treated pine wooden fence at around £20 per linear foot. This includes the materials and labour costs. Wire fencing is technically cheaper at around £5 per foot, but it’s not a great material to use in homes as it looks unsightly and doesn’t provide any privacy.
